This stunning print captures the timeless beauty and allure of Caroline (La Belle) Otero, a legendary Spanish dancer and seductress who captivated audiences in Paris during the early 20th century. The photograph, taken by Reutlinger in 1901, showcases La Belle Otero's grace and elegance as she poses for the camera with confidence.
The postcard featuring her autograph adds a personal touch to this historical image, providing a glimpse into the life of a woman who was known for her charm and charisma. La Belle Otero's legacy as one of Europe's most famous dancers is evident in this portrait, which has been preserved in the collection of Jaime Abecasis.
